THE BEST WINTER VEG COLESLAW



The best winter veg coleslaw image

Coleslaw is something most of us have grown up eating, yet a lot of the time it must have been made so badly! With this in mind, I want to bring it back with a vengeance. I've used yoghurt instead of mayonnaise to bind the vegetables because it not only tastes better, in my opinion, but it's also healthier.

Time 20m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 carrots, different colours if you can find them
1 bulb fennel
3-4 radishes, use at least two out of this, the beetroot, celeriac and cabbage
1 light-coloured beetroot, use at least two out of this, the radishes, celeriac and cabbage
½ small celeriac, use at least two out of this, the radishes, beetroot and cabbage
400 g red and white cabbage, use at least two out of this, the radishes, beetroot and celeriac
½ red onion
1 shallot
1 lemon
extra virgin olive oil
250 ml yoghurt
2 tablespoons mustard
1 handful fresh soft herbs (use mint, fennel, dill, parsley and chervil)

Steps:

  • Peel the carrots and trim the fennel. If you're using beetroot or celeriac, peel these. Remove the outer leaves of the cabbage, if using.
  • Shred the carrots, fennel, and your choice of radishes, beetroot, turnip or celeriac on a mandolin (use the guard), or use the julienne slicer in your food processor. Put the veg into a mixing bowl.
  • Peel the onion and shallot, and slice as finely as you can, along with the cabbage, if using. Add these to the bowl of veg.
  • In a separate bowl, mix half the lemon juice, a lug of extra virgin olive oil, yoghurt and mustard. Pick the herb leaves and chop, then stir into the dressing.
  • Pour the dressing over the veg and mix well to coat everything. Season to taste with sea salt, freshly ground black pepper and the rest of the lemon juice, if you like.
  • Really delicious served with thinly sliced leftover roast lamb, pork or rare roast beef, drizzled with extra virgin olive oil.

CHRISTMAS COLESLAW



Christmas Coleslaw image

In our family, this is a must-have side dish for Christmas dinner. The colorful slaw combines sweet, crunchy and nutty ingredients with tongue-tingling results. It's such a refreshing counterpoint to our meaty main course. -Lyndsay Wells, Ladysmith, BC

Time 15m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 package (14 ounces) coleslaw mix
1 medium Granny Smith apple, chopped
1 cup slivered almonds, toasted
1/2 cup maraschino cherries, halved
1 cup reduced-fat mayonnaise
1/4 cup 1% milk
2 tablespoons unsweetened applesauce
3/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1 can (11 ounces) mandarin oranges, drained

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ine coleslaw mix, apple, almonds and cherries; toss to combine. In a small bowl, whisk mayonnaise, milk, applesauce, salt, paprika and pepper until blended. Pour over coleslaw mixture; toss to coat. Gently stir in mandarin oranges. Refrigerate until serving.

TRADITIONAL COLESLAW

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/4 head (about 1 pound) green cabbage
2 carrots
1/3 cup mayonnaise
1/3 cup sour cream
1 tablespoon cider vinegar
1 tablespoon sugar
1/2 teaspoon celery seed
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• Shred cabbage with a sharp knife. Grate carrots; combine with cabbage in a large bowl.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together mayonnaise, sour cream, vinegar, sugar, celery seed, salt, and pepper. Add dressing to cabbage mixture, and toss to combine. Serve immediately, or store in the refrigerator for up to 2 days.

CHRISTMAS SLAW



Christmas slaw image

A nutty winter salad which is superhealthy, quick to prepare and finished with a light maple syrup dressing

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 carrots, halved
½ white cabbage, shredded
100g pecans, roughly chopped
bunch spring onions, sliced
2 red peppers, deseeded and sliced
2 tbsp maple syrup
2 tsp Dijon mustard
8 tbsp olive oil
4 tbsp cider vinegar

Steps:

  • Peel strips from the carrots using a vegetable peeler, then mix with the other salad ingredients in a large bowl. Combine all the dressing ingredients in a jam jar, season, then put the lid on and shake well. Toss through the salad when you're ready to eat it. The salad and dressing will keep separately in the fridge for up to four days.

SERIOUSLY GOOD HOMEMADE COLESLAW



Seriously Good Homemade Coleslaw image

With a generous amount of acidity from apple cider vinegar and Dijon mustard, our coleslaw recipe is anything but dull. Instead, it is packed with fresh, lively flavors that wake up anything you serve with it. Unlike some of the more traditional or popular recipes for coleslaw, we skip the addition of sugar to our coleslaw dressing. Try this as a topping to sandwiches, served next to ultra-savory meats, like braised beef or pork. Or, mound some on top of your next hot dog or hamburger. Sugar: We find that the cabbage and carrots are sweet enough. If you disagree, add a teaspoon or two of sugar (or honey) to the dressing before mixing with the cabbage and carrot.

Time 25m

Yield Makes approximately 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 medium cabbage (about 2 pounds), outer leaves removed
3 medium carrots, peeled and shredded
1/2 cup loosely packed fresh parsley leaves, coarsely chopped
1 cup (170 grams) mayonnaise, try our homemade mayonnaise recipe
2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ar or more to taste
2 tablespoons Dijon mustard or coarse ground mustard
1 teaspoon celery seeds
1/4 teaspoon fine sea salt or more to taste
1/4 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per or more to taste
1 to 2 teaspoons sugar or honey, optional, add for a sweeter coleslaw

Steps:

  • Quarter the cabbage through the core, and then cut out the core. Cut each quarter crosswise in half and finely shred. Place the shredded cabbage in a very large bowl (you will have 6 to 8 cups).
  • Add the shredded carrot and parsley to the cabbage and toss to mix.
  • In a separate bowl, stir the mayonnaise, vinegar, mustard, celery seeds, salt, and pepper together. Taste for acidity and seasoning, then adjust as desired. If the dressing tastes too tart and you prefer a sweeter coleslaw, stir in the optional sugar.
  • Pour two-thirds of the dressing over the cabbage and carrot then mix well. (Clean hands are the quickest tool).
  • If the coleslaw seems dry, add a little more of the dressing. Eat right away or let it sit in the refrigerator for about an hour to let the flavors mingle and the cabbage to soften.

SWEET AND SOUR SLAW



Sweet and sour slaw image

Here is an exercise in chopping meditation for you! There is much to slice, but you end up with a bright tangle of slaw that feeds a crowd and has enough zing in it to bring a table of cold cuts to life.

Yield Serves 10-12

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 red cabbage (approx. 800g/1lb 12oz), halved
4 fat or 6 skinny spring onions, trimmed
2 red peppers, membranes and seeds removed
1 yellow pepper, membranes and seeds removed
1 orange pepper, membranes and seeds removed
1 red chilli, seeds removed
large bunch (approx. 100g/3½oz) fresh coriander
250ml/9fl oz pineapple juice, from a carton
2 limes, preferably unwaxed
1½ tbsp sea salt flakes, or to taste
2 tsp toasted sesame oil
2 tsp maple syrup

Steps:

  • Shred the cabbage thinly and put into the largest bowl you have. It may be easier to use a huge saucepan as you need to toss all the ingredients together later, and even my largest mixing bowl isn't big enough.
  • Slice the spring onions into batons and then cut each baton into thin slices lengthways, so that you, again, have shreds. Add to the cabbage.
  • Cut the peppers into very thin slices. Add to the cabbage and spring onions.
  • Finely chop the red chilli, and do the same with the coriander - stalks and leaves. Add the chilli and all but a tablespoon of the chopped coriander to the cabbage bowl.
  • In a bowl or measuring jug, mix together the pineapple juice, the zest and juice of 1 lime and the juice of half of the second. Sprinkle in the salt, add the sesame oil and maple syrup, and whisk together before pouring over the prepared vegetables. Toss to mix, then leave to stand for at least 15 minutes, and up to 2 hours, before serving. Sprinkle the reserved tablespoonful of chopped coriander over the finished slaw.
